Let’s play the blame game...
Why do we play this game?
* So that we can call others BAD and make ourselves feel better.
* So that we can have a higher STATUS when the other person is labeled bad.
* So that we can PROJECT our feelings onto others and not feel bad about ourselves.
* So that we can EXPLAIN what caused the problem beside ourselves.
* So that we can DEFEND ourselves and not feel attacked.
* So that we can PUNISH the person and make them believe that they are bad and we are innocent.
Blame shifting is a way of shame dumping our own weaknesses and faults; hence it’s so easy to blame something or someone else instead of owning up to your part in the game of blame.
